Goodness Nose - win signed copies!


Books by true Scotch whisky 'insiders' are rare, and in Goodness Nose one of the industry's highest profile figures, master blender Richard Paterson, teams up with our own Gavin D Smith to chronicle his life and times over more than four decades in the whisky business.

Glasgow-born Paterson is a third generation master blender, and the bulk of his career has been spent with Whyte & Mackay, working not only to develop the firm's range of blends, but also with its Dalmore, Jura and Fettercairn single malts.

The 'revelations' of the title take the form of inviting the reader into Paterson's blending room, where for the first time he demonstrates the 'nuts and bolts' of how blends are created, including contributions from a number of his fellow blenders in addition to his own chosen modus operandi.

The book is illustrated with an excellent selection of photographs, most previously unpublished, and is the ideal Christmas present for whisky lovers everywhere.
